YouView creates software for set-top boxes, streaming pucks, and smart TVs to deliver a TV experience users love. YouView’s TV experience is powered by our reliable, resilient, and secure cloud backend, and our unique firmware allows us to control media playback, security and lower-level components. Our platform delivers variety and convenience by combining on-demand with live TV through an integrated editorial lens, so our users get the best rich, relevant TV content across both free and pay services.
YouView has proudly collaborated with Everyone TV to introduce Freely, a ground-breaking streaming service that is set to revolutionise free TV in the UK. Launched in April 2024, Freely offers users a seamless experience by providing a single access point to stream live and on-demand content from all major UK broadcasters, eliminating the hassle of app-switching.
The Role
Often the “first port of call” for YouView employees within the People & Culture team, this role is focused on providing a high quality and positive employee experience. You will be essential to the planning and execution of operational HR duties. Attention to detail and the enthusiasm to drive continuous improvement are essential attributes, together with a diplomatic manner and confidential approach.
- Engagement & Communication
- Handling day to day enquiries from staff or third parties and providing relevant information, responding accurately, professionally and in a timely manner
- Draft and distribute employee communications (particularly those in relation to reward and benefits) using a variety of channels.
- Contribute to the drafting and updating of HR policies ensuring they are accessible for all
- Design and run new joiner process, including contracts, inductions and Peakon 101 sessions
- Lead our wellbeing initiatives
- Employee Lifecycle
- Manage the administration of the recruitment process (with opportunity to build upon this skillset if desired)
- Draft contracts, offer letters, amendments and other confidential and legally compliant documents
- Coordinate onboarding activities including right to work checks, references and new starter and leaver administration
- Manage absence tracking, probation reviews
- Support disciplinary, grievances and exit processes, including responsibility for exit interviews
- Reward & Benefits
- Execute the monthly (UK only) payroll, with support initially from the People team Lead
- Run the benefit administration process end to end.
- Resolve payroll queries from staff, acting as a point of liaison between YouView and our payroll providers.
- Support the People team lead to plan & execute annual processes such as pay reviews, benefit renewals, performance reviews, benchmarking.
- HR Infrastructure & Systems
- Accountable for the accuracy of all employee data and documentation in our HRIS (HiBob) and in line with GDPR
- Become an administrative superuser of all our software (Reward Gateway, Peakon, Learnerbly, HiBob), actively implementing new features when available
- Proactively identify and execute enhancements to our systems to improve the employee experience and ease of use in the backend.
- Ensure operational processes are mapped, documented, and communicated with the wider People team, including template documents and forms
- Provide data and reporting upon request
This role will also require generalist knowledge of all aspects of HR and will need to pick up any other ad hoc duties and contribute to the overall team effort.
